namespace cel { | ||
|
||
namespace { | ||
|
||
class BasicStructType; | ||
|
||
class BasicStructTypeFieldIterator final : public StructTypeFieldIterator { | ||
public: | ||
explicit BasicStructTypeFieldIterator(const BasicStructType& type) | ||
: type_(type) {} | ||
|
||
bool HasNext() override; | ||
|
||
absl::StatusOr<StructTypeFieldId> Next() override; | ||
|
||
private: | ||
const BasicStructType& type_; | ||
size_t field_index_ = 0; | ||
}; | ||
|
||
class BasicStructType final : public StructTypeInterface { | ||
public: | ||
BasicStructType(std::string name, std::vector<StructTypeField> fields, | ||
absl::flat_hash_map<int64_t, size_t> fields_by_number, | ||
absl::flat_hash_map<absl::string_view, size_t> fields_by_name) | ||
: name_(std::move(name)), | ||
fields_(std::move(fields)), | ||
fields_by_number_(std::move(fields_by_number)), | ||
fields_by_name_(std::move(fields_by_name)) {} | ||
|
||
absl::string_view name() const override { return name_; } | ||
|
||
size_t field_count() const override { return fields_.size(); } | ||
|
||
absl::StatusOr<absl::optional<StructTypeFieldId>> FindFieldByName( | ||
absl::string_view name) const override { | ||
if (auto field = fields_by_name_.find(name); | ||
field != fields_by_name_.end()) { | ||
return StructTypeFieldId(absl::in_place_type<size_t>, field->second); | ||
} | ||
return absl::nullopt; | ||
} | ||
|
||
absl::StatusOr<absl::optional<StructTypeFieldId>> FindFieldByNumber( | ||
int64_t number) const override { | ||
if (auto field = fields_by_number_.find(number); | ||
field != fields_by_number_.end()) { | ||
return StructTypeFieldId(absl::in_place_type<size_t>, field->second); | ||
} | ||
return absl::nullopt; | ||
} | ||
|
||
absl::string_view GetFieldName(StructTypeFieldId id) const override { | ||
return fields_.at(id.Get<size_t>()).name; | ||
} | ||
|
||
int64_t GetFieldNumber(StructTypeFieldId id) const override { | ||
return fields_.at(id.Get<size_t>()).number; | ||
} | ||
|
||
absl::StatusOr<Type> GetFieldType(StructTypeFieldId id) const override { | ||
return fields_.at(id.Get<size_t>()).type; | ||
} | ||
|
||
absl::StatusOr<absl::Nonnull<StructTypeFieldIteratorPtr>> NewFieldIterator() | ||
const override { | ||
return std::make_unique<BasicStructTypeFieldIterator>(*this); | ||
} | ||
|
||
private: | ||
friend class BasicStructTypeFieldIterator; | ||
|
||
NativeTypeId GetNativeTypeId() const noexcept override { | ||
return NativeTypeId::For<BasicStructType>(); | ||
} | ||
|
||
const std::string name_; | ||
const std::vector<StructTypeField> fields_; | ||
const absl::flat_hash_map<int64_t, size_t> fields_by_number_; | ||
const absl::flat_hash_map<absl::string_view, size_t> fields_by_name_; | ||
}; | ||
|
||
bool BasicStructTypeFieldIterator::HasNext() { | ||
return field_index_ < type_.fields_.size(); | ||
} | ||
|
||
absl::StatusOr<StructTypeFieldId> BasicStructTypeFieldIterator::Next() { | ||
if (ABSL_PREDICT_FALSE(field_index_ >= type_.fields_.size())) { | ||
return absl::FailedPreconditionError( | ||
"StructTypeFieldIterator::Next() called when " | ||
"StructTypeFieldIterator::HasNext() returns false"); | ||
} | ||
return StructTypeFieldId(absl::in_place_type<size_t>, field_index_++); | ||
} | ||
|
||
} // namespace | ||
|
||
absl::StatusOr<StructType> StructType::Create( | ||
MemoryManagerRef memory_manager, absl::string_view name, | ||
SizedInputView<StructTypeFieldView> fields) { | ||
if (ABSL_PREDICT_FALSE(name.empty())) { | ||
return absl::InvalidArgumentError("struct type name must not be empty"); | ||
} | ||
std::vector<StructTypeField> copied_fields; | ||
size_t field_count = 0; | ||
copied_fields.resize(fields.size()); | ||
absl::flat_hash_map<int64_t, size_t> numbers; | ||
numbers.reserve(fields.size()); | ||
absl::flat_hash_map<absl::string_view, size_t> names; | ||
names.reserve(fields.size()); | ||
for (const auto& field : fields) { | ||
if (field.number < 0) { | ||
if (!field.name.empty()) { | ||
return absl::InvalidArgumentError( | ||
absl::StrCat("struct type fields require a number: `", name, ".", | ||
field.name, "`")); | ||
} | ||
continue; | ||
} | ||
const auto field_index = field_count++; | ||
auto& copied_field = copied_fields[field_index]; | ||
copied_field = StructTypeField(field); | ||
if (!field.name.empty()) { | ||
auto names_insertion = | ||
names.insert({absl::string_view(copied_field.name), field_index}); | ||
if (ABSL_PREDICT_FALSE(!names_insertion.second)) { | ||
return absl::InvalidArgumentError(absl::StrCat( | ||
"struct type `", name, "` contains values with duplicate names")); | ||
} | ||
} | ||
auto numbers_insertion = numbers.insert({copied_field.number, field_index}); | ||
if (ABSL_PREDICT_FALSE(!numbers_insertion.second)) { | ||
return absl::InvalidArgumentError(absl::StrCat( | ||
"struct type `", name, "` contains values with duplicate names")); | ||
} | ||
} | ||
copied_fields.resize(field_count); | ||
return StructType(memory_manager.MakeShared<BasicStructType>( | ||
std::string(name), std::move(copied_fields), std::move(numbers), | ||
std::move(names))); | ||
} | ||
